The word of the month for me is Patience.
 
This past weekend I was among many parents making the trek down to UW's Nordstrom Tennis Center to watch the High School 2A Tennis Championships. I have been attending for many years but this year was a bit different, my daughter Eloise was playing in the doubles bracket. I have watched plenty of tennis and have been very invested in the play of many of our own Bellingham tennis players. I have experienced the emotions of the wins and losses, to some degree, of the players and myself as a coach. I would always look at the matches as great learning experiences. I could stay positive in a tough loss and be supportive in the whole experience win or lose. Having your own daughter playing is just a bit different. I may say, I am glad I have some finger nails left because I was worried I might chew them all off after watching her matches.
 
The experience I realized is hers, not mine. I needed to remove my need to criticize/coach and let her feel the joy of winning and the pain of losing. I needed to be happy that she had earned the experience of participating in the State Tournament and be proud that she was out there competing.
 
Patience is something all parents need to excel at if you want to make it through raising a child. I had to keep my urge to coach and critique her game and let her learn through the experience. I know that I need to continue working on patience when living with this person that used to rely so heavily on me and now needs to show her independence from me. This part of my life is by far the most challenging part of being a coach and a father in regard to patience.

TENNIS TIP

 
Did You Know?
 

1.    That in doubles the receiving team loses a point if the receiver's partner touches the net while the ball is in play.



 

2.     That there is "the Code" which is the unwritten rules of fair play in tennis. Here are some of these rules:

            * A ball that can't be called out is in.
            * Courtesy is expected
            * Let is called when a ball rolls on the court
            * Talking between doubles partners when the ball is moving toward them is allowed
            * Doubles players should not talk when the ball is moving toward their opponent's court. * Have fun while playing....It is a game! (my code)
